A personal device may perform a first triangulation using signal strength information of connections between the personal device and a plurality of in-vehicle components of a vehicle. A secured function request may be sent from the personal device to an access component of the vehicle when a location of the personal device is determined to be within the vehicle by the personal device. Signal strength information of the personal device may be forwarded to the access component from the plurality of in-vehicle components. The personal device may receive a response from the access component granting the secured function request when the forwarded signal strength information confirms the location of the second personal device as being within the vehicle.
